Ken Runfast is the star of the cross-country team. During a recent morning run, Ken averaged a speed of 5.69 m/s for 11.3 minutes. Ken then averaged a speed of 6.31 m/s for 8.7 minutes.

Determine the total distance which Ken ran during his 20 minute jog.

Answer:

Ken ran a total distance of approximately 7154.44 meters during his 20 minute jog.

Step-by-step explanation:

To find the total distance Ken ran, we can use the formula:

distance = speed x time

First, let's convert the time to seconds:

11.3 minutes = 11.3 x 60 = 678 seconds

8.7 minutes = 8.7 x 60 = 522 seconds

Now we can use the formula to calculate the distance:

distance1 = speed1 x time1 = 5.69 m/s x 678 s = 3863.62 m

distance2 = speed2 x time2 = 6.31 m/s x 522 s = 3290.82 m

The total distance Ken ran is the sum of the two distances:

total distance = distance1 + distance2 = 3863.62 m + 3290.82 m = 7154.44 m

Therefore, Ken ran a total distance of approximately 7154.44 meters during his 20 minute jog.
